On Thu, 2009-11-19 at 21:05 +0000, Sam Fourman Jr. wrote:
> I am running a Fresh install of amd64 FreeBSD 8.0 RC3
> when running firefox It locks up for a moment then is fine then when I
> load a new page it locks up again.
> here is the error I get in the console when running native firefox 3.5
> 
> what do I have to rebuild inorder to fix this?

It really looks like this is Linux firefox, not native firefox.  AFAIK,
we don't have a native Flash 10 plug-in for FreeBSD yet.  If this really
is native Firefox, consider posting to freebsd-gecko.
